### **Luis Díaz ‘Surprised’ by Liverpool’s U-Turn on Contract Extension Talks**

Liverpool winger **Luis Díaz** has reportedly been left **“surprised and disappointed”** after the club unexpectedly backtracked on plans to begin talks over a contract extension, according to *Rousing The Kop*.

Earlier in the season, **informal discussions were anticipated** to take place once the campaign concluded, with Díaz and his representatives confident that his strong performances under new manager Arne Slot had earned him an upgraded deal. The Colombian international played a key role in Liverpool’s title-winning campaign, contributing with goals, assists, and relentless energy on the left wing.

However, the club’s stance has taken an **unexpected turn** — and it now appears that **no formal contract renewal offer is on the table**, nor is one expected in the near future. This sudden shift has reportedly **caught Díaz’s camp off guard**, especially considering his growing importance within the squad.

Despite this, Liverpool have made it clear they **do not intend to sell** the 27-year-old. The Reds have already turned down interest from **Barcelona**, who are believed to be long-time admirers of Díaz. Still, the club is understood to have a **valuation prepared** in case serious bids arrive — particularly with **Saudi Pro League clubs** monitoring his situation closely.

The decision not to push ahead with new terms raises questions about the long-term vision under Arne Slot and how Díaz fits into that picture. While not officially on the transfer list, the existence of an internal price tag suggests **Liverpool could be open to letting him go** — if the offer is right.

As the summer transfer window heats up, **Díaz’s future is once again in the spotlight** — with both European giants and Middle Eastern clubs circling. Whether Liverpool are making a strategic decision or risking the morale of one of their standout performers remains to be seen.
